- 23': Own Goal by Alexandre Penetra, FC Famalicão. FC Famalicão 0, Portimonense 1.
- 39': Goal! FC Famalicão 0, Portimonense 2. Carlinhos (Portimonense) right footed shot from the left side of the box to the bottom left corner. Assisted by Shoya Nakajima.
- 45'+2': First Half ends, FC Famalicão 0, Portimonense 2.
- 45': Substitution, FC Famalicão. Marcos Paulo replaces Charles Pickel.
- 45': Second Half begins FC Famalicão 0, Portimonense 2.
- 45': Substitution, FC Famalicão. David Tavares replaces Pedro Brazão.
- 45': Substitution, FC Famalicão. Heriberto Tavares replaces Iván Jaime.
- 54': Iván Angulo (Portimonense) is shown the yellow card.
- 59': Willyan (Portimonense)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
- 62': Pedro Sá (Portimonense) is shown the yellow card.
- 70': Substitution, Portimonense. Filipe Relvas replaces Iván Angulo.
- 70': Goal! FC Famalicão 0, Portimonense 3. Aylton Boa Morte (Portimonense) right footed shot from the right side of the box to the bottom left corner. Assisted by Fahd Moufi with a headed pass.
- 75': Ivo Rodrigues (FC Famalicão)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
- 77': Substitution, FC Famalicão. Bruno Rodrigues replaces Ivo Rodrigues.
- 77': Substitution, FC Famalicão. Hernán De La Fuente replaces Adrián Marín.
- 85': Substitution, Portimonense. Giannelli Imbula replaces Fabrício.
- 85': Substitution, Portimonense. Wilinton Aponza replaces Shoya Nakajima.
- 90': Substitution, Portimonense. Ewerton replaces Carlinhos.
- 90': Substitution, Portimonense. Anderson Oliveira replaces Aylton Boa Morte because of an injury.
- 90'+5': Second Half ends, FC Famalicão 0, Portimonense 3.
